Truly Sad Picture

The picture of the drowned bodies of Oscar Alberto Martinez Ramirez and his two-year-old daughter, Valeria, was shocking. They were trying to cross over the Rio Grande from Mexico into the United States.

The two, plus the wife and mother, Tania Vanessa Avalos, were fleeing poverty in El Salvador and had secured a humanitarian visa in Mexico. They were in a migrant camp for two months waiting for asylum in the U.S.

To me, it would take a truly unfeeling person to begrudge them for desiring to want to come to our country, and to flee their country that is mired in poverty and gang crime. I do think a lot of people who say our country can't take anymore immigrants, truly, deep down, realize that is not America's overriding, premier problem.

It's something our country has always done in times of peril--displace the blame. At various times it been the Jews, the Catholics, the Chinese, the Irish, the Italians, the Germans. Enter now the Mexicans and those of the Islamic faith.

President Trump was the right person at the right time to bring the Nativism to fruition.

And it's going to take a lot of people over a lot of time to set things right.
